Sauvignon Blanc is a grape selection that’s used to make white wine. It’s characterised by its crisp, refreshing acidity and its flavors of citrus, grapefruit, and herbs. Sauvignon Blanc is grown in many various areas world wide, however it’s notably well-known for its wines from the Loire Valley in France and the Marlborough area of New Zealand.

The title Sauvignon Blanc comes from the French phrases “sauvage,” which means “wild,” and “blanc,” which means “white.” That is regarded as a reference to the grape’s origins within the wild vineyards of southwestern France.

Sauvignon Blanc is a flexible grape selection that can be utilized to make a variety of wines, from dry to candy, and from nonetheless to glowing. It’s usually blended with different grape varieties, comparable to Semillon and Cabernet Sauvignon, to create extra complicated wines.
